Entry Level Environmental Engineer, Geologist or Scientist

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-06-17

Jacobs is a company focused on solving critical problems for thriving cities and resilient environments. They are looking for an entry-level Environmental Engineer, Geologist, or Scientist to work on site characterization and remediation projects, gaining valuable field and office experience in environmental consulting.

Responsibilities

  • Work on site characterization and remediation projects for government and private-sector clients
  • Gain valuable field experience with environmental sampling techniques and subcontractor oversight
  • Balance field work with office tasks such as data interpretation and visualization, quantitative modeling, report writing, and coordinating field work
  • Ensure environmental compliance, environmental management, and health and safety while working on diverse projects

Skills

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Engineering (Environmental, Civil, or Chemical Engineering or preferred), Geology, or Environmental Science
  • 0-2 years of experience within environmental consulting or related field
  • Ability to travel for field projects up to 50-90% of the time
  • United States Citizenship required
  • Valid Drivers License required
  • Strong attention to detail and exc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work both independently with minimal supervision and in a team environment
  • Experience with Microsoft Office software
  • 40-hr HAZWOPER certification or the ability to attain this certification
